Spears To Open MTV Video Music Awards

Singer Won't Perform, But Will Do Something 'Fun And Unexpected'

Britney Spears won't perform at the MTV Video Music Awards this weekend, but will open the show with something "fun and unexpected," according to MTV president Van Toffler.

Spears confirmed the gig in a statement: "MTV has long played an important role in my career. How can I not be there to kick off their 25th VMAs? I'm excited to open the entire show, to say hi to my fans and to be nominated."

Toffler said that he thinks people are "rooting" for Spears and said that she's "on the road to recovery."

"It feels like it's her year," Toffler said, noting that the pop singer is nominated for three awards. "It's our 25th anniversary of the VMAs, and she's been such a critical piece of MTV's history."

That history includes her critically lambasted performance last year in less-than-good shape and her infamous kiss with Madonna in 2003.

Toffler said that the network is trying to get Michael Jackson to appear on the show, too.

"We've been talking to him as well, I don't know if that's going to happen," Toffler said. "People fall in and fall out up until the day of the show."
